<div style=' background:#FFFFFF;color:#000000;font-family:Verdana;width:auto;padding:5px;max-height:100%;'><span><p><a href="https://www.instagram.com/ericgarcetti/">Eric Garcetti</a>, the US Ambassador to India, marked his first anniversary in the country on May 13 by sharing a video highlighting the key milestones achieved by him. The video, filmed at the <a href="https://in.usembassy.gov/">US Embassy</a> in New Delhi, features Garcetti discussing the productive year of 2023, noting various agreements, paperwork, and accomplishments while enjoying "desi kadak chai."</p><p>In the video, Garcetti reflects on his travels across 22 states and union territories, where he made friends, received gifts, and enjoyed diverse local cuisines. He mentions visits from Wagah to Kanyakumari and Mumbai to Kohima, emphasizing the significant trade between the two nations, valued at $200 billion, and praising the <a href="https://www.npci.org.in/">UPI system</a>.</p><p>Garcetti also highlights the collaboration between <a href="https://www.nasa.gov/">NASA </a>and <a href="https://www.isro.gov.in/">ISRO</a> on the <a href="https://nisar.jpl.nasa.gov/">NISAR</a> satellite, set to launch later this year, as a significant achievement in the US-India relationship. Sharing the video on social media, he expressed appreciation for the deepening ties and shared dreams between the two countries.</p><p>In defense cooperation, Garcetti celebrated record military exercises aimed at enhancing peace and interoperability between the US and India. He also highlighted environmental sustainability efforts, including financing 10,000 new electric buses and establishing a large solar manufacturing plant in southern India with US support.</p><p>Healthcare cooperation was another focus, with collaborative efforts in vaccine development for diseases like dengue and malaria. Garcetti also noted improvements in visa processing, reducing wait times and increasing the number of visas issued, making India a leading source of international students.</p><p>As he concluded, Garcetti expressed optimism about the future of the US-India partnership, anticipating further achievements in the years to come.Fair Use disclaimer: Media in this post is used in accordance with the fair use doctrine under United States Copyright law.
